Now the substance. Cymphony was founded in 2023. It closed its first sales year with annual recurring revenue in the seven-figure range — meaning somewhere between one million and nine million dollars, though the language used ("hit seven figures in its first sales year") strongly implies the lower half of that band. It raised twenty-five million in this round. Cumulative funding sits at about thirty million. The post-money valuation is described as "over" one hundred million, a phrasing that almost always means just barely over — not one-fifty, not two hundred.
Run the arithmetic and you land on a multiple between roughly thirty-three and one hundred times ARR. Hold that number. I will return to it, because whether it is a bubble signal or a bargain depends entirely on which comparison set you choose, and the choice is not innocent.
The customer list is where the real signal lives, and it is more interesting than the valuation. KKR — a global private equity firm regulated across multiple jurisdictions. Syngenta — an agricultural multinational sitting on sensitive supply-chain and biological data. Cass Information Systems — a publicly traded payments and logistics data processor bound by Sarbanes-Oxley. The common thread is not industry. The common thread is that all three are data-dense and heavily regulated. That combination — regulated plus data-dense — is precisely the buyer profile that will pay a premium for governance tooling, and precisely the buyer profile that will never, ever purchase a protocol instead of a vendor.
This is the first load-bearing fact of my argument, so I will state it plainly and then defend it for the next several thousand words. The AI-agent governance market is not a technology market. It is a compliance market. Compliance markets do not buy architectures. They buy receipts.

Core: A Compliance Market Wearing an Engineering Costume
The Identity-First Wedge Is Real but Thin
The most defensible part of Cymphony's thesis is its entry point. Most AI-security companies attack the problem from the prompt: guardrails, jailbreak detection, content filtering. That is the Lakera layer, the Robust Intelligence layer — probabilistic filters wrapped around a model's input and output. Cymphony attacks from identity instead. Before an agent reads a file, before it calls a tool, the question is who authorized it and under what authority. That is a categorical difference, not an incremental one.

Here is the problem with the wedge. If your differentiator is "we govern agent identity," then you have entered a race whose finish line is owned by Microsoft. Entra already hosts agent identity management. Purview already provides shadow-AI discovery and data-exposure-surface management. The two capabilities that Cymphony's coverage describes as its core functions — finding files exposed by AI tooling, and surfacing unauthorized AI adoption — are not novel capabilities. They are existing capabilities with a new noun attached.
This is where the engineering-first deconstruction matters. Strip the branding and Cymphony's "workforce graph" is a union of three established categories: data security posture management, identity threat detection and response, and user-and-entity behavioral analytics. DSPM has existed for years under Cyera, Varonis, and BigID. ITDR is a mature label. UEBA predates all of them. The claim to originality is that these signals are unified around identity rather than around endpoints or data stores. That is a packaging choice dressed as a paradigm. It is not a new computation. It is a new join key.
I am not being dismissive for sport. A new join key can be a genuinely valuable product. But it cannot be defended the way a new computation can. It can be copied by any platform vendor with access to the same three signal sources — and every platform vendor has them.
The Consolidation Was Already Over Before the Round Closed
Look at the exit tape in this category over the preceding eighteen months. Palo Alto Networks bought Protect AI. Cisco bought Robust Intelligence. Check Point bought both Lakera and Lasso Security. SentinelOne bought Prompt Security. F5 bought CalypsoAI. Cyera bought Oasis Security. That is not a market discovering its winners. That is a market whose winners have already been selected by acquisition.
At least five to six exits preceded Cymphony's round. When a category has absorbed that many acquisitions before a Series A-stage company raises, the strategic message is unambiguous: the category is validated, and the independent-company ceiling is confirmed. The natural end-state of a market with this shape is a small number of platform vendors and one or two high-value point solutions that get absorbed into them at a premium. Cymphony is, whether it admits it or not, optimizing to be one of the absorbed.
This is the difference between a blue-ocean story and a crowding story. The coverage frames Cymphony as riding a wave of validation. The wave already crashed. What Cymphony is riding is the backwash.

The Platform Vendors Are the Ceiling, Not the Competitors
The structural threat to Cymphony is not another startup. It is free. Microsoft has folded agent identity management into Entra and shadow-AI discovery into Purview. Palo Alto, Zscaler, Netskope, CrowdStrike, Varonis, and Cyberhaven have each added AI-usage governance to suites that enterprises already pay for. When the incumbent platform bundles your core function at zero marginal cost, your product must clear a much higher bar than "it works." It must deliver an order-of-magnitude advantage that survives a procurement meeting in which the alternative is a free checkbox.
I want to be precise about what Cymphony needs to prove to survive that meeting, because the coverage omits every single one of these facts.
First: inline or out-of-band? Does Cymphony block an agent action in flight, or does it detect and alert after the fact? This is not a feature question. It is an order-of-magnitude difference in both difficulty and value. Inline enforcement requires sitting in the request path, which means latency budgets, failure modes, and the terrifying engineering reality that a broken control plane becomes an outage. Out-of-band detection requires sitting in a log stream, which is a data problem. One of these is a hard company. The other is a dashboard. The coverage does not say which one Cymphony is.
Second: what is the relationship to Entra Agent ID and Purview? Compete or integrate? If a customer already pays Microsoft for identity and data governance, what is Cymphony's incremental value? A product whose value proposition is "we do what your platform does, but as a standalone vendor" has a lifespan measured in renewal cycles.
Third: does it govern agent-to-agent and agent-to-tool traffic at runtime, or only audit it after the fact? A governance system that only produces a report is a governance system that arrives after the damage.
Fourth, and this is the omission that tells me the most: the coverage says nothing about the Model Context Protocol ecosystem. This is not a small gap. It is the single most valuable new control point in the entire category, and its absence from a funding narrative is loud.

It also taught me where the attack surface actually is, and it is not where the content-filter vendors are looking.
The real vulnerability of the agent economy is not the prompt. It is the tool chain. When an agent can invoke external tools through a protocol like MCP, every tool becomes an injection vector. A poisoned tool description. A malicious MCP server that returns attacker-controlled context. A prompt injection that propagates across a tool call into a downstream agent and then into a payment authorization. The blast radius is not a single model output. It is a cascade.
This is a provenance problem. It is a supply-chain problem. And provenance and supply-chain integrity are precisely the problems that cryptographic attestation solves well and that centralized log analysis solves badly. If you want to know whether the tool an agent just called is the tool it claims to be, a signature verifies that. A dashboard that says "we saw a call" does not.

The Valuation, Decoded
Return to the multiple. Thirty-three to one hundred times ARR sounds like a bubble. Does it survive contact with the comparison set?
Public security vendors — CrowdStrike, Palo Alto — trade in the range of ten to twenty-five times ARR. That is the floor of the comparison. Private AI-security leaders have transacted at forty to sixty times ARR. Cyera's multi-billion valuation against its revenue lands squarely in that band. Against that set, Cymphony's multiple is at the top of the private range but does not exceed the historical extreme of the private security market.
So the valuation is aggressive but not unprecedented. The more revealing number is the dilution. Twenty-five million raised against a post-money valuation of roughly one hundred million implies a twenty-four to twenty-five percent equity give. Series A rounds typically dilute fifteen to twenty percent. Letting go of a quarter of the company while ARR is barely into the low seven figures tells you either that the team was desperate for capital or that Sequoia had the pricing power of a name that closes follow-on rounds. Probably both. The power dynamic of that round is legible in the dilution, and it is not a founder-favorable dynamic.
Now consider the cumulative picture. Thirty million raised in total, of which twenty-five is this round. That means early rounds — seed and pre-seed — totaled roughly five million. If the seed round cleared at a post-money of twenty to thirty million, then two years of execution produced a three-to-five-times price step. In a period when AI and security seed-to-A rounds were routinely stepping five to ten times, that is a restrained repricing. Restraint of that kind is genuinely good news: it lowers the probability of a down round at the next raise. A company that did not get ahead of itself is a company that can survive a sideways market without a haircut.

The Investor Structure Says More Than the Product
Two investors carry signal beyond the dollars. Sequoia has been on the right side of the security category repeatedly — Okta, Palo Alto, Wiz, Vanta. A lead from that name at this stage is one of the strongest quality markers available in private markets. That is not nothing. It is, in fact, the single most credible fact in the entire funding narrative.
The second investor is more interesting and completely unexplored by the coverage. The round included a fund whose name appears to be a garbled or translated reference to a Japanese financial group fund — plausibly connected to Sumitomo Mitsui. If that reading is correct, the strategic meaning is direct: a large Japanese bank group has a compliance-driven need for AI-agent governance, tied to the Japanese regulator's requirements for financial-systems resilience. That kind of investor does not write a check for a generic SaaS story. It writes a checklist. It is buying a distribution channel into Japanese financial institutions, and it is buying a seat at the table where the governance requirements for agent deployment in regulated finance get defined.
That is the real second-order value of this round, and the coverage did not mention it. Cymphony has, quietly, secured a route into the most compliance-sensitive enterprise market on earth. If the identity-first wedge survives anywhere, it survives there, because that is where the willingness to pay for governance is highest and the willingness to adopt a protocol is lowest.
One more observation about the client mix, because it bears on the quality argument. KKR, Syngenta, and Cass are three customers, not three hundred. But in enterprise security, three logos from the top of the regulated pyramid are worth more than three hundred mid-market logos, because they signal that the product cleared the procurement bar of the most demanding buyers. The coverage's use of Sequoia's own internal adoption as evidence is, by contrast, worth almost nothing. "Our investor uses us" is a standard public-relations bridge in security funding narratives, deployed historically at Okta, Wiz, and Vanta. It proves usability. It does not prove differentiation. And a security product that is merely usable, in a category where the platform vendors give away usable, is a security product with a clock on it.
